What the FCE0 error code actually means
Your Whirlpool dishwasher is displaying an FCE0 error because two of its internal control boards have stopped communicating with each other. This is often caused by a loose wire connection rather than a failed part. The dishwasher shuts down as a safety measure until the communication link is restored.

Most common causes of FCE0
- 1Loose wiring connections at the ECM
- 2Loose or faulty connection on ECM L1 or Neutral lines
- 3Faulty or damaged communication bus wiring
- 4Failed ECM board
- 5Failed main control board
